# Bellog Notion CMS Integration

This skill defines how to work with Notion as a CMS in the Bellog blog project.

## Architecture Overview

Bellog uses **Notion as a headless CMS**:
- Content is managed in a Notion database
- Data is fetched via Notion API
- Content is rendered using react-notion-x
- Caching with Next.js for performance

## Caching Strategy

### Pattern from `/src/lib/posts.ts`

**Two-level caching:**
1. React `cache()` - Request deduplication
2. Next.js `unstable_cache()` - Persistent caching

```typescript
import { cache } from "react";
import { unstable_cache } from "next/cache";
import { getAllPostsFromNotion } from './notion';

export const getAllPosts = cache(
  unstable_cache(
    async () => {
      const posts = await getAllPostsFromNotion();

      // Sort by date descending
      return posts.sort((a, b) =>
        new Date(b.date).getTime() - new Date(a.date).getTime()
      );
    },
    ["all-posts"], // Cache key
    {
      revalidate: 3600, // 1 hour
      tags: ["posts", "notion"] // For invalidation
    }
  )
);
```

### Why Two Levels?

- **React cache():** Prevents duplicate fetches in single render
- **unstable_cache():** Persists data across requests with TTL

### Cache Keys

```typescript
["all-posts"]           // All posts list
["post-{slug}"]         // Individual post
["post-recordmap-{id}"] // Post content
```

### Cache Tags

```typescript
["posts", "notion"]     // Tag for bulk invalidation
```

## On-Demand Revalidation

### API Route

**File:** `/src/app/api/revalidate/route.ts`

```typescript
import { revalidateTag } from 'next/cache';

export async function POST(request: Request) {
  // Verify secret
  const secret = request.nextUrl.searchParams.get('secret');

  if (secret !== process.env.REVALIDATION_SECRET) {
    return Response.json(
      { message: 'Invalid secret' },
      { status: 401 }
    );
  }

  // Invalidate cache
  revalidateTag('notion');

  return Response.json({
    revalidated: true,
    now: Date.now()
  });
}
```

### Usage

**Trigger from Notion webhook:**
```bash
curl -X POST "https://bellog.com/api/revalidate?secret=YOUR_SECRET"
```

**Manual trigger:**
```bash
curl -X POST "http://localhost:3000/api/revalidate?secret=dev_secret"
```

### What Gets Revalidated

All cached data with tag `"notion"`:
- Post list
- Individual posts
- Tag counts

## Environment Variables

### Required in `.env.local`

```bash
# Official Notion API
NOTION_API_KEY=secret_x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
NOTION_DATABASE_ID=x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x

# notion-client (for react-notion-x)
NOTION_TOKEN_V2=v02%3Auser_token_or_cookie...
NOTION_ACTIVE_USER=xxxxxx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xxxxxxxxxx

# Cache revalidation
REVALIDATION_SECRET=your_random_secret_string
```

### Getting Values

**NOTION_API_KEY:**
1. Go to https://www.notion.so/my-integrations
2. Create new integration
3. Copy "Internal Integration Token"

**NOTION_DATABASE_ID:**
1. Open database in Notion
2. Copy ID from URL: `notion.so/workspace/[THIS_PART]?v=...`

**NOTION_TOKEN_V2:**
1. Open Notion in browser
2. DevTools → Application → Cookies
3. Copy `token_v2` value

**NOTION_ACTIVE_USER:**
1. Same location as token_v2
2. Copy `notion_user_id` value

### Notion API Rate Limits

**Limits:**
- 3 requests per second
- Averaged over 1-minute window

**Mitigation:**
- Caching with `unstable_cache`
- Revalidate on-demand instead of frequent polling
- Use TTL (1 hour) to reduce API calls

## Best Practices

### 1. Always Cache

```typescript
// ✅ Correct - Always use caching
export const getPosts = cache(
  unstable_cache(
    async () => await notion.query(...),
    ['key'],
    { revalidate: 3600 }
  )
);

// ❌ Wrong - Direct API calls
export async function getPosts() {
  return await notion.query(...); // No caching!
}
```

### 2. Handle Missing Data

```typescript
// ✅ Correct - Provide defaults
const title = page.properties.title?.title?.[0]?.plain_text || 'Untitled';

// ❌ Wrong - Can crash if undefined
const title = page.properties.title.title[0].plain_text;
```

### 3. Use Tags for Invalidation

```typescript
// ✅ Correct - Use tags
unstable_cache(
  fetchFunction,
  ['key'],
  { tags: ['posts', 'notion'] } // Can invalidate by tag
);

// ❌ Wrong - No tags
unstable_cache(
  fetchFunction,
  ['key'],
  {} // Can't invalidate efficiently
);
```

### 4. Separate Concerns

```typescript
// ✅ Correct - API calls in notion.ts, caching in posts.ts
// /src/lib/notion.ts
export async function getAllPostsFromNotion() { }

// /src/lib/posts.ts
export const getAllPosts = cache(unstable_cache(...));

// ❌ Wrong - Mix concerns
export const getAllPosts = async () => {
  const response = await notion.databases.query(...); // Mixed!
}
```

### 5. Type Everything

```typescript
// ✅ Correct - Explicit types
import type { PageObjectResponse } from '@notionhq/client/build/src/api-endpoints';

const page = result as PageObjectResponse;

// ❌ Wrong - Any types
const page: any = result;
```
